Akbar Rahideh is a scholar working on Control and Systems Engineering,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Akbar Rahideh has authored 98 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 70 papers in Control and Systems Engineering, 61 papers in Electrical and Electronic Engineering and 30 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Akbar Rahideh's work include Electric Motor Design and Analysis (52 papers), Magnetic Bearings and Levitation Dynamics (42 papers) and Magnetic Properties and Applications (30 papers). Akbar Rahideh is often cited by papers focused on Electric Motor Design and Analysis (52 papers), Magnetic Bearings and Levitation Dynamics (42 papers) and Magnetic Properties and Applications (30 papers). Akbar Rahideh collaborates with scholars based in Iran, United Kingdom and United States. Akbar Rahideh's co-authors include Theodosios Korakianitis, Mohammad Hasan Shaheed, Mohammad Mardaneh, Frédéric Dubas, Abdulrahman H. Bajodah, Mohammad Sadegh Helfroush, Amirhossein Rajaei, Azam Bagheri, Martin T. Rothman and H.J.C. Huijberts and has published in prestigious journals such as Scientific Reports, IEEE Transactions on Industrial Electronics and Applied Energy.
